Proposed Tasks

Critical and Immediate

  • Vendor List Compilation due in 1 week
    ☐ Identify all existing vendors ☐ Collect contact details ☐ Document the products/services they provide
  • Vendor Communication Channel Setup due in 2 weeks
    ☐ Determine preferred communication channels for each vendor ☐ Set up necessary accounts or software

Critical but Not Immediate

  • Vendor Contract Review due in 1 month
    ☐ Review all existing vendor contracts ☐ Identify any changes needed ☐ Plan for contract renegotiations if necessary
  • Vendor Payment Schedule Setup due in 2 months
    ☐ Determine payment schedules for each vendor ☐ Set reminders for payments

Not Critical but Immediate

  • Vendor Performance Evaluation due in 3 months
    ☐ Develop a vendor performance evaluation system ☐ Start evaluating vendor performance on a regular basis
  • Vendor Issue Resolution Process due in 4 months
    ☐ Create a process for resolving issues with vendors ☐ Communicate the process to all relevant staff

Not Critical or Immediate

  • Vendor Communication Protocol Training due in 5 months
    ☐ Develop a training program for staff on the vendor communication protocol ☐ Conduct the training
  • Vendor Emergency Plan due in 6 months
    ☐ Create a plan for emergencies related to vendors (e.g., a vendor going out of business) ☐ Share the plan with all relevant staff
